8th Grade

Stephen and I were in 8th grade together in the old Thomaston High School. I was invited to Alicia Burns' birthday party at the grange hall in Thomaston.  It was my first boy/girl dance party and since he sat right in front of me in school and was a nice boy, I asked him to go with me. When I got to the party, I was so nervouse that I stood on the sidelines and didn't go near him. Eventually he crossed the room and asked me to dance......first boy I ever danced with!  I think we only danced once or twice but that was fine with me because I was so nervous. Stephen was a nice person who did me a big favor by going to the dance so I wouldn't show up with no one to dance with even though we hardly danced! A growing up memory I've never forgotten. So, so sad to hear of his passing. I'm glad he had a nice life with lots of love and family. He deserved it.
